如何通过可观测性平台实现IT运维的全面监控

随着信息技术的飞速发展,企业对于IT运维的要求越来越高。如何通过可观测性平台实现IT运维的全面监控,已经成为企业关注的焦点。本文将从可观测性平台的概念、实现方式以及应用价值等方面,对如何实现IT运维的全面监控进行探讨。

一、可观测性平台的概念

可观测性平台是指一种能够全面监测、分析和可视化IT系统运行状态的工具。它通过收集、处理和分析系统运行数据,帮助企业发现潜在问题,提高运维效率。可观测性平台主要包括以下功能:

  1. 监控:实时监测IT系统的运行状态,包括CPU、内存、磁盘、网络等资源使用情况。

  2. 日志分析:分析系统日志,挖掘潜在问题,为运维人员提供决策依据。

  3. 性能分析:对系统性能进行量化评估,发现性能瓶颈,优化资源配置。

  4. 可视化:将系统运行数据以图表、报表等形式展示,便于运维人员直观了解系统状态。

二、实现IT运维全面监控的方式

  1. 数据采集

数据采集是可观测性平台实现全面监控的基础。企业可以通过以下几种方式采集数据:

(1)系统自带的监控工具:许多操作系统和应用程序都提供了自带的监控工具,如Linux的sysstat、Windows的Performance Monitor等。

(2)第三方监控工具:市场上有很多专业的监控工具,如Nagios、Zabbix、Prometheus等,可以满足企业不同场景的监控需求。

(3)自定义脚本:针对特定需求,企业可以编写自定义脚本,实时采集系统数据。


  1. 数据处理与分析

采集到的数据需要经过处理和分析,才能为运维人员提供有价值的信息。数据处理与分析主要包括以下步骤:

(1)数据清洗:去除无效、重复的数据,确保数据质量。

(2)数据聚合:将相关数据合并,形成更具有代表性的指标。

(3)异常检测:通过设定阈值,发现异常数据,及时报警。

(4)关联分析:分析不同指标之间的关系,挖掘潜在问题。


  1. 可视化展示

可视化展示是可观测性平台的重要功能,可以帮助运维人员直观了解系统状态。可视化展示主要包括以下方面:

(1)实时监控:展示系统运行状态的实时数据,如CPU、内存、磁盘、网络等。

(2)历史数据:展示系统运行状态的历史数据,便于分析问题发生的原因。

(3)报表生成:根据需求生成各类报表,如性能报表、故障报表等。

三、可观测性平台的应用价值

  1. 提高运维效率

通过可观测性平台,运维人员可以实时了解系统运行状态,及时发现并解决问题,从而提高运维效率。


  1. 降低运维成本

可观测性平台可以帮助企业优化资源配置,降低运维成本。


  1. 提高系统稳定性

通过全面监控,企业可以及时发现系统潜在问题,预防故障发生,提高系统稳定性。


  1. 优化业务发展

可观测性平台为企业提供了丰富的数据资源,有助于企业分析业务发展趋势,优化业务发展策略。

总之,通过可观测性平台实现IT运维的全面监控,有助于企业提高运维效率、降低运维成本、提高系统稳定性,为企业业务发展提供有力保障。在信息化时代,企业应积极引入可观测性平台,实现IT运维的全面监控。

猜你喜欢:全栈可观测